8 DLR.de/SF > Chart 8 > >Institute of Solar Research 2016 > E Luepfert, DLR > Seminario CORFO and GIZ 7 Sept 2016 Current developments in CSP parabolic trough commercial plant size MW 30% larger aperture size of trough collectors, bigger receiver tubes molten salt as heat transfer medium for troughs and linear Fresnel higher temperature (550 C) double storage capacity 5% better power block efficiency direct steam generation at commercial scale, but without storage new silicone fluid as heat transfer medium process heat applications in food and mining industry solar tower commercial plant size MW molten salt as heat transfer medium, also in combination with steam pressurized air or atmospheric air as heat transfer medium long term: solar fuels and hydrogen

17 DLR.de/SF > Chart 17 > >Institute of Solar Research 2016 > E Luepfert, DLR > Seminario CORFO and GIZ 7 Sept 2016 Application fields for solar thermal process heat, e.g. steam Food and beverage industry: Dairies and bakeries - Drying, cleaning, cooking, deep frying, baking, pasteurization Slaughter houses Rendering process, steam cooking, cooling and refrigeration Wineries, breweries, distilleries Steam juicing, sterilization, distillation Product industry: Mining and oil industry Ore leaching, galvanic processes, oil recovery, cleaning Textile and leather industry - Dying, shaping, ironing, tanning Cement and ceramic industry Drying, burning, calcination Paper industry Bleaching, thermo-mechanical pulping, drying Pharmaceutical and chemical industry - Process specific applications, distillation Plastics and rubber industry - Heating, cooling, vulcanization Hotel and tourism industry - Laundry, heating, cooling, water treatment and desalination

19 DLR.de/SF > Chart 19 > >Institute of Solar Research 2016 > E Luepfert, DLR > Seminario CORFO and GIZ 7 Sept 2016 Application examples solar process heat in Chile Process heat supply for mining camp hot water for showers, replace diesel fuel Process heat supply for copper mine hot water for electro-winning, replace diesel fuel Process steam for copper smelter 100% solar during daytime Hot water supply for mining process heap leaching, reduce fuel consumption by 30%
